Llantwit Major station provides essential amenities to make your travel experience smooth. While there isn't a ticket office on site, you can easily collect your pre-purchased tickets from the station's ticket machines. For those who rely on smartcards, you'll find validators but not issuance facilities here. Accessibility is a key consideration, with step-free access to platforms 1 and 2 ensuring ease of movement for those with reduced mobility. The station is category B2, indicating that step-free access is available in parts but requires a bit of navigation between platforms via a footbridge or a detour. CCTV cameras keep an eye on the premises for added security.
For those continuing their journey by bus, the nearest stop is conveniently located on Le Pouliguen Way, making it easy to catch a ride to various local destinations. Cycling enthusiasts won't miss out either, thanks to the dedicated bicycle storage and the option to hire a bike through Brompton Bike Hire, which is located close to the station car park. Although there are no accessible taxis available, you can find more details on car hire and taxis through local services.

Upper Warlingham station is fully equipped to cater to typical travel needs with facilities that ensure a hassle-free experience.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with both a ticket office and self-service machines available. The ticket office is open weekdays from 06:35 to 19:55, Saturdays until 14:00, and Sundays until 15:45, offering flexibly scheduled human support in case you need it. Convenient for those purchasing or collecting tickets online, our accessible machines can accommodate all passengers, including those with a Disabled Persons Railcard.
Though the station lacks a waiting room, seating areas are readily available, ensuring comfort while you wait. With regular staff support on-site, a helpful presence is always there when needed. Plus, enjoy some peace of mind with the comprehensive CCTV coverage ensuring a safe environment.
Upper Warlingham train station is also accommodating to cyclists with 22 bike storage spaces available, clearly positioned in the car park. Security of your bikes is assured with effective CCTV monitoring. Step-free access is possible to one of the platforms (the London-bound service), but do note that access to the other platform requires the use of steps. Assistance services are a call away, should you need any help navigating the station or boarding your train.
Upper Warlingham train station is conveniently connected to a variety of transport options. If by chance your route gets derailed, there is a rail replacement service that substitutes trains with buses when needed. Although the station itself doesn’t provide a direct bus service, information for local buses is conveniently displayed in the station.
Taxis are easily accessible from the front of the station to whisk you to your further destination. However, please note that there are no accessible taxis available at the station. If driving, the spacious car park with 240 spaces operates 24/7, and offers CCTV-monitored parking bays - making Upper Warlingham a practical choice whether traveling by foot or wheel!
